However, the capacity of these microbes to breakdown the uric acid and urea and utilize … mail fngal-info-support.comWebThese animals are called ureotelic. Urea is a less toxic compound than ammonia; two nitrogen atoms are eliminated through it and less water is needed for its excretion. It requires 0.05 L of water to excrete 1 g of nitrogen, approximately only 10% of that required in ammonotelic organisms. ...
